  • Day 1

    Bozeman pickup, zip-line tour across Gallatin River, explore Yellowstone and Old Faithful

    #2093

    Your trip begins with a pickup in Bozeman and shuttles to Big Sky, Montana where you'll start your adventure with a zip line tour across the Gallatin River. After lunch, it's time to explore Yellowstone! Upon arrival at the Upper Geyser Basin, we’ll hike in a back way, traversing through a less crowded area of bubbling hot springs to the main attraction – Old Faithful. After checking into your home for the night, enjoy dinner at the historic Old Faithful Inn where you’ll have a chance to watch Old Faithful erupt under the stars. Designated as a national historic monument, Old Faithful Inn was built in 1903-1904 with local logs and stone. With its long history, stunning stone fireplace, and proximity to its namesake, it’s easy to see why this rustic lodge is the most requested lodging in Yellowstone National Park.

    Old Faithful Inn or Old Faithful Snow Lodge (Lunch, Dinner)

    Hiking: 2-3 miles (3-5 kilometers)

  • Day 3

    Hike Grand Canyon of Yellowstone

    #2095

    This morning we’ll check out the Yellowstone River’s Upper Falls where the water flows powerfully over the brink. From there we can appreciate the waterfall’s power and spend time here. We’ll set off on a hike on the Wapiti Trail - this hike will bring us to the rim of the 10,000-year-old, 1,000-foot deep Grand Canyon of the Yellowstone River. As we carefully make our way along the canyon wall, at every bend the pinks, yellows, reds, and oranges of the rock appear all the more bright as you walk to the grand finale of Artist Point, the most spectacular viewpoint of the Lower Falls of the Yellowstone River. We’ll enjoy lunch here before making our way down Uncle Tom’s trail.

    Mammoth Hot Springs Hotel or Canyon Lodge (Breakfast, Lunch, Dinner)

    Hiking: 4-6 miles (6-9 kilometers)

  • Day 5

    Yellowstone Hot Spring Soak, horseback ride the Absaroka Mountains

    #2097

    Today we'll have a leisurely morning with breakfast at the hotel followed by a Yellowstone Hot Spring Soak. Relax under incredible views while soaking in the steaming waters of the hot plunge or take an invigorating dip in the cold plunge. Or choose to bask in the soothing 102-degree F average of the main pool. After a picnic lunch, we’ll drive through Paradise Valley to the Flying Diamond Ranch. The Flying Diamond Ranch is a fifth generation family-owned and operated commercial cattle ranch located in eastern Montana. Here we’ll saddle up for an unforgettable horseback ride into the Absaroka Mountains alongside the fifth-generation ranchers. Afterwards, we’ll head to the historic Chico Hot Springs Resort, this resort is located in the heart of Paradise Valley, nestled in the foothills of the breathtaking Absaroka Mountain Range. Here we can soak in the rejuvenating mineral waters before gathering in the resort’s dining room for a celebratory gourmet dinner in one of Montana’s finest restaurants.

    Chico Hot Springs Resort (Breakfast, Lunch, Dinner)

    Horse-back Riding: 2 hours
